The peak of university rugby, which has been in the works for about three months, is finally about to begin! The long-awaited fall college rugby season is finally here. The Kanto University Rugby League is a league packed with traditional schools. Attention is focused on Waseda University, which won last season with a perfect record, Teikyo University, which is currently on a four-year winning streak at the National University Championship, and Meiji University, which is hoping to revive its legacy. While the Kanto University League is a competitive arena, last season Daito Bunka University won, ending Tokai University’s six-game winning streak. This season, a fierce battle for the top spots is expected, centered around Daito Bunka University, Toyo University, and Tokai University. In the Kansai University League, attention will be focused on whether other universities can compete with the two strongest teams, Tenri University, last season’s champion, and Kyoto Sangyo University, a semi-finalist in the university championship. Attention is focused on whether other universities can compete with last season’s champions, Tenri University, and Kyoto Sangyo University, a semi-finalist in the university championship. One of the attractions of university rugby is the brilliance of promising star players, an aspect not to be overlooked. Players selected for the Japan National Team/JAPAN XV include Yoshitaka Yazaki (Waseda University), Jingo Takenoshita (Meiji University), and U23 Japan National Team members Chuka Ishibashi (Kyoto Sangyo University), Eito Shirai (Meiji University), and Kenso Tanaka (Waseda University). Don’t miss the performances of these players who are expected to excel in the Japan National Team and Japan Rugby League One in the future.
